<p>Over the past few years, Sega has released quite a lot of <strong><a href="http://www.nintendolife.com/games/gameboy/puyo_puyo">Puyo Puyo</a></strong> games on the Nintendo Switch. We got <strong><a href="http://www.nintendolife.com/games/nintendo-switch/puyo_puyo_tetris">Puyo Puyo Tetris</a></strong> in 2017 and <strong><a href="http://www.nintendolife.com/games/switch-eshop/puyo_puyo_champions">Puyo Puyo Champions</a></strong> was localised last year. The Sega AGES version of the <a href="http://www.nintendolife.com/games/switch-eshop/sega_ages_puyo_puyo">original</a> was also made available here in the west in 2019 and earlier this month <strong>Puyo Puyo Tsu</strong> arrived in Japan.</p>
<p>If you still need more Puyo Puyo in your life, then you should consider tuning into Sega’s ‘Puyo Day 2020 Livestream’ next month on 4th February (8:00 pm JST) over on <a class="external" href="https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=e4Vcor_aTho">YouTube</a> or the Japanese video streaming service <a class="external" href="https://live2.nicovideo.jp/watch/lv323987269">NicoNico Live</a>. Sega will reportedly be sharing “24 pieces of news” during the broadcast – including updates on each Puyo Puyo title – and there’ll also be various events such as a segment featuring the top Puyo Puyo Champions players.</p>
<p>For some added context, “2-4” reads as “Pu-Yo” in Japanese, which matches the date of Puyo Day (February 4) and also explains why exactly 24 news items will be shared during the event (thanks, Siliconera).
